RSPB Scotland has submitted an objection to a proposal for a pumped storage hydro scheme in Argyll and Bute. The nature conservation charity, which supports renewables in the right locations, has shared significant concerns about the impact on crucially important peatland habitat.

A proposal has been submitted for the development of affordable homes on Arran on behalf of Trust Housing Association.
